A quick definition of medio tempore:
Term: medio tempore
Definition: Medio tempore means "in the meantime" in Latin. It is a term used in history to refer to the time between two events or actions. For example, if someone is waiting for a decision to be made, they may say "medio tempore" to indicate that they are waiting in the meantime.
A more thorough explanation:
Term: medio tempore
Definition: Medio tempore is a Latin term that means "in the meantime." It is used to describe something that happens during the period of time between two events or actions.
Examples: While waiting for her friend to arrive, Sarah decided to read a book. Medio tempore, the doorbell rang and her friend had arrived. Another example is when John was waiting for his flight at the airport. Medio tempore, he decided to grab a bite to eat at a nearby restaurant. These examples illustrate how medio tempore is used to describe something that happens during a period of waiting or in between two events.
